David Blaine Do Not Attempt, a six-part series from Brian Grazer and Ron Howard’s Imagine Documentaries, is slated to bow on National Geographic on March 23 and begin streaming on Disney+ and Hulu the next day.
The series sees the titular magician meet with performers and masters around the world to witness their exceptional skills. As he immerses himself in their cultures, histories and hidden rituals, he learns and attempts their tricks, from sword swallowing to surviving venomous stings and kissing king cobras.
The show serves as a celebration of pushing boundaries safely and responsibly, rooted in years of training, preparation and a process of refinement. Viewers are reminded throughout the series that professionals do all of the feats shown with safety teams to prevent any accidents, and none of the activities on screen should ever be practiced at home.
Blaine travels to Brazil, Southeast Asia, India, the Arctic Circle, South Africa and Japan throughout the six episodes.
David Blaine Do Not Attempt is produced by Imagine Documentaries for National Geographic. Executive producers are Grazer, Howard, Blaine, Sara Bernstein, Justin Wilkes, Christopher St. John, Matthew Akers, Erica Sashin and Toby Oppenheimer.
